प्रस्थान 14
1 तब परमप्रभुले मोशालाई भन्नु भयो,
2 “इस्राएलीहरूलाई पी-हहीरोत फर्की जानु भन। तिनीहरूलाई भन, मिग्दोल अनि समुद्रको बीचमा बालसपोन कै नजिक छाउनी लगाऊ।’
3 फिरऊनले सोच्नेछ इस्राएलका मानिसहरू मरूभूमिमा हराए छन्। अनि उसले सोच्नेछ मानिसहरूको जाने ठाउँ छैन।
4 म फिरऊनलाई अट्टेरी बनाउनेछु अनि उसले तिमीहरूको खेदो गर्नेछ, तर म फिरऊन र उसका सेनाहरूलाई पराजित गराउनेछु। तब मिश्रदेशका मानिसहरूले जान्नेछन् कि म परमप्रभु हुँ।”
5 इस्राएलका मानिसहरू भागे भन्ने समाचार फिरऊनले थाहा पायो। जब फिरऊन र उसका अधिकारीहरूले पनि यो खबर सुने, तिनीहरूले के गरेका थिए त्यस विषयमा आफ्नो विचार बद्ली गरे। फिरऊनले भने, “हामीहरूले किन इस्राएली मानिसहरूलाई तिनीहरूको दासत्वबाट जान दियौं?”
6 यसर्थ फिरऊनले आफ्नो रथ ठीक पार्यो अनि आफूसंगै आफ्नो मानिसहरूलाई लियो।
7 उसले आफ्नो सर्वश्रेष्ठ मानिसहरूमध्ये 600 जना अनि आफ्नो सारा रथहरू लिए। प्रत्येक रथमा एकजना अधिकारी थिए।
8 इस्राएलका मानिसहरू निडर साथ बढिरहेका थिए, तर परमप्रभुले फिरऊनलाई अट्टेरी बनाइ दिनु भयो, यसर्थ उसले इस्राएलीहरूलाई खेद्यो।
9 मिश्री फौजसित धेरै घोडा, सेना अनि रथहरू थिए। तिनीहरूले इस्राएलीहरूलाई खेदे र लाल समुद्रको नजिक बालसिपोनमा जहाँ तिनीहरूले छाउनी लगाएका थिए तिनीहरूलाई पक्रे।
10 इस्राएलीले फिरऊनलाई उसका मिश्रदेशीहरूसित आउँदै गरेको देखे। तिनीहरू साह्रै डराएका थिए अनि तिनीहरूले परमप्रभुलाई गुहार मागे।
11 तिनीहरूले मोशालाई भने, “तिमीले हामीहरूलाई मिश्रबाहिर किन ल्यायौ? मिश्रमा के धेरै चिहानहरू थिएनन्? किन? तिमीले हामीलाई मरूभूमिमा मार्न ल्यायौं।
12 हामीले मिश्रमा तिमीलाई भनेका थियौं “यस्तो परी आउनेछ। ‘मिश्रमा हामीले भनेका थियौ कि हाम्रो चिन्ता नगर्नु होस्।’ हामीलाई मिश्रमा बस्न दिनुहोस र मिश्र वासीहरूको सेवा गर्न देऊ। यसरी मरूभूमिमा आएर मर्नु भन्दा त त्यही बसी कमारा-कमारी हुनु नै असल थियो।”
13 तर मोशाले उत्तर दिए, “नडारऊ तिमीहरू जहाँ छौ यही उभिने काम गर अनि हेर आज परमप्रभुले तिमीहरूलाई बचाउनु हुनेछ। तिमीहरूले यी मिश्रबासीलाई फेरि कहिल्यै देख्ने छैनौ।
14 तिमीहरूले केही गर्नु पर्दैन तर स्थिर भएर बस। परमप्रभुले तिमीहरूको निम्ति युद्ध गर्नु हुनेछ।”
15 तब परमप्रभुले मोशालाई भन्नुभयो, “अहिलेसम्म मसंग तिमी किन कराइरहेका छौ? इस्राएली मानिसहरूलाई अघि बढन शुरू गर्नु भन।
16 लाल समुद्रमाथि तिम्रो लाठी उठाऊ अनि समुद्र दुइ भाग हुन्छ, तब मानिसहरू सूखा जमीनमा हिंडेर जानेछन्।
17 मिश्रदेशका मानिसहरूले तिमीहरूलाई खेदिरहेका छन् किनभने मैले तिनीहरूलाई अट्टेरी बनाएको छु। तर म फिरऊन र उसको घोडा तथा रथहरू भन्दा शक्तिशाली छु भन्ने तिमीलाई देखाउने छु।
18 तब मिश्रदेशवासीहरू जान्नेछन् कि म परमप्रभु हुँ। जब म फिरऊन, उसका सेना, घोडाहरू तथा रथहरूलाई पराजित पार्नेछु तब त्यहाँका मानिसहरूले मलाई आदर गर्नेछन्।”
19 तब परमप्रभुका स्वर्गदूत मानिसहरूका पछि लागे। (परमप्रभुका स्वर्गदूत खास गरी मानिसहरूलाई डोर्याउन तिनीहरूका अघि-अघि थिए।) यसकारण बादलको खामो मानिसहरूको अघिबाट सरेर पछाडिपट्टि गयो।
20 यसरी त्यो बादल इस्राएली अनि मिश्रदेशी मानिसहरूको माझमा उभियो। यसले इस्राएलीहरूलाई उज्यालो दियो अनि मिश्रदेशी मानिसहरूलाई अँध्यारो। अँध्यारोले गर्दा फिरऊनका सेनाहरू इस्राएलीहरूको नजिक आउन सकेनन्।
21 मोशाले आफ्नो लहुरो लाल समुद्रमाथि उठाए अनि परमप्रभुले पूर्वबाट तेजसित बतास चलाइदिनुभयो। बतास रात भरी नै चलिरह्यो, पूर्वीय बतासले समुद्रलाई सुकाइदियो अनि यसलाई दुइ भाग पारि दियो।
22 इस्राएलका मानिसहरू सूखा जमीनमाथि हिंडेर समुद्र पार गरे। तिनीहरूको दाहिने र देब्रेपट्टि समुद्रको पानी पर्खाल झै उभिएको थियो।
23 फिरऊनका घोडसैनिक अनि रथहरूले इस्राएलीहरूलाई समुद्र बीचमा खेदे।
24 एकाबिहानै परमप्रभुले बादल अनि आगोको खाँबोबाट मिश्रका सेनालाई हेर्नु भयो। अनि उहाँले तिनीहरूलाई आक्रमण गर्नु भयो अनि पराजित पार्नु भयो।
25 रथका पाङग्राहरू भासिए अनि रथलाई नियन्त्रणमा राख्न कठिन पर्यो। मिश्रदेशका मानिसहरू जोरले कराए, “हामी यहँबाट भागौं, परमप्रभु हाम्रो विरूद्ध इस्राएलका मानिसहरूको पक्षमा लडाइँ गर्नु हुँदैछ।”
26 तब परमप्रभुले मोशालाई भन्नु भयो, “समुद्रमाथि तिम्रो लहुरो उठाऊ जसले गर्दा पानी मिश्रहरूका घोडाहरू र रथहरूमाथि फर्केर जाऊन्।”
27 यसकारण बिहान उज्यालो हुनअघि मोशाले आफ्नो लहुरो समुद्रमाथि उठाए अनि समुद्र फेरि पानीले भरियो। मिश्रका मानिसहरू त्यहाँबाट भाग्ने चेष्टा गर्दै थिए तर परमप्रभुले तिनीहरूलाई समुद्रमा डुबाएर मारिदिनु भयो।
28 त्यसको पानी पहिलाको स्थानमा फर्कियो अनि रथ र घोडाहरू सबैलाई डुबायो। फिरऊनका सम्पूर्ण सेनाहरू जो इस्राएलीहरूलाई खेद्दै आएका थिए डुबेर नष्ट भए। तिनीहरू कोही पनि बाँचेनन्।
29 समुद्रको पानी भाग-भाग भएर इस्राएलीहरूको दाहिने र देब्रेपट्टि उभियो र इस्राएलका मानिसहरू सूखा जमीनमा हिंडेर पारि गए।
30 यसरी त्यस दिन परमप्रभुले इस्राएलीहरूलाई बचाउनु भयो र ती मानिसहरूले मिश्री मानिसहरू लाल समुद्रको किनारमा देखे।
31 इस्राएलका मानिसहरूले परमप्रभुको महाशक्ति थाह पाए जब उहाँले मिश्रका सेनाहरूलाई परास्त गर्नु भयो। यसकारण मानिसहरू परमप्रभुसित डराए। तिनीहरूले फेरि परमप्रभु र उहाँका सेवक मोशामाथि विश्वास गर्नु थाले।
1 And the Lord spake unto Moses, saying,
2 Speak unto the children of Israel, that they turn and encamp before Pi-hahiroth, between Migdol and the sea, over against Baal-zephon: before it shall ye encamp by the sea.
3 For Pharaoh will say of the children of Israel, They are entangled in the land, the wilderness hath shut them in.
4 And I will harden Pharaoh’s heart, that he shall follow after them; and I will be honoured upon Pharaoh, and upon all his host; that the Egyptians may know that I am the Lord. And they did so.
5 And it was told the king of Egypt that the people fled: and the heart of Pharaoh and of his servants was turned against the people, and they said, Why have we done this, that we have let Israel go from serving us?
6 And he made ready his chariot, and took his people with him:
7 And he took six hundred chosen chariots, and all the chariots of Egypt, and captains over every one of them.
8 And the Lord hardened the heart of Pharaoh king of Egypt, and he pursued after the children of Israel: and the children of Israel went out with an high hand.
9 But the Egyptians pursued after them, all the horses and chariots of Pharaoh, and his horsemen, and his army, and overtook them encamping by the sea, beside Pi-hahiroth, before Baal-zephon.
10 And when Pharaoh drew nigh, the children of Israel lifted up their eyes, and, behold, the Egyptians marched after them; and they were sore afraid: and the children of Israel cried out unto the Lord.
11 And they said unto Moses, Because there were no graves in Egypt, hast thou taken us away to die in the wilderness? wherefore hast thou dealt thus with us, to carry us forth out of Egypt?
12 Is not this the word that we did tell thee in Egypt, saying, Let us alone, that we may serve the Egyptians? For it had been better for us to serve the Egyptians, than that we should die in the wilderness.
13 And Moses said unto the people, Fear ye not, stand still, and see the salvation of the Lord, which he will shew to you to day: for the Egyptians whom ye have seen to day, ye shall see them again no more for ever.
14 The Lord shall fight for you, and ye shall hold your peace.
15 And the Lord said unto Moses, Wherefore criest thou unto me? speak unto the children of Israel, that they go forward:
16 But lift thou up thy rod, and stretch out thine hand over the sea, and divide it: and the children of Israel shall go on dry ground through the midst of the sea.
17 And I, behold, I will harden the hearts of the Egyptians, and they shall follow them: and I will get me honour upon Pharaoh, and upon all his host, upon his chariots, and upon his horsemen.
18 And the Egyptians shall know that I am the Lord, when I have gotten me honour upon Pharaoh, upon his chariots, and upon his horsemen.
19 And the angel of God, which went before the camp of Israel, removed and went behind them; and the pillar of the cloud went from before their face, and stood behind them:
20 And it came between the camp of the Egyptians and the camp of Israel; and it was a cloud and darkness to them, but it gave light by night to these: so that the one came not near the other all the night.
21 And Moses stretched out his hand over the sea; and the Lord caused the sea to go back by a strong east wind all that night, and made the sea dry land, and the waters were divided.
22 And the children of Israel went into the midst of the sea upon the dry ground: and the waters were a wall unto them on their right hand, and on their left.
23 And the Egyptians pursued, and went in after them to the midst of the sea, even all Pharaoh’s horses, his chariots, and his horsemen.
24 And it came to pass, that in the morning watch the Lord looked unto the host of the Egyptians through the pillar of fire and of the cloud, and troubled the host of the Egyptians,
25 And took off their chariot wheels, that they drave them heavily: so that the Egyptians said, Let us flee from the face of Israel; for the Lord fighteth for them against the Egyptians.
26 And the Lord said unto Moses, Stretch out thine hand over the sea, that the waters may come again upon the Egyptians, upon their chariots, and upon their horsemen.
27 And Moses stretched forth his hand over the sea, and the sea returned to his strength when the morning appeared; and the Egyptians fled against it; and the Lord overthrew the Egyptians in the midst of the sea.
28 And the waters returned, and covered the chariots, and the horsemen, and all the host of Pharaoh that came into the sea after them; there remained not so much as one of them.
29 But the children of Israel walked upon dry land in the midst of the sea; and the waters were a wall unto them on their right hand, and on their left.
30 Thus the Lord saved Israel that day out of the hand of the Egyptians; and Israel saw the Egyptians dead upon the sea shore.
31 And Israel saw that great work which the Lord did upon the Egyptians: and the people feared the Lord, and believed the Lord, and his servant Moses.
1 Then came near the heads of the fathers of the Levites unto Eleazar the priest, and unto Joshua the son of Nun, and unto the heads of the fathers of the tribes of the children of Israel;
2 And they spake unto them at Shiloh in the land of Canaan, saying, The Lord commanded by the hand of Moses to give us cities to dwell in, with the suburbs thereof for our cattle.
3 And the children of Israel gave unto the Levites out of their inheritance, at the commandment of the Lord, these cities and their suburbs.
4 And the lot came out for the families of the Kohathites: and the children of Aaron the priest, which were of the Levites, had by lot out of the tribe of Judah, and out of the tribe of Simeon, and out of the tribe of Benjamin, thirteen cities.
5 And the rest of the children of Kohath had by lot out of the families of the tribe of Ephraim, and out of the tribe of Dan, and out of the half tribe of Manasseh, ten cities.
6 And the children of Gershon had by lot out of the families of the tribe of Issachar, and out of the tribe of Asher, and out of the tribe of Naphtali, and out of the half tribe of Manasseh in Bashan, thirteen cities.
7 The children of Merari by their families had out of the tribe of Reuben, and out of the tribe of Gad, and out of the tribe of Zebulun, twelve cities.
8 And the children of Israel gave by lot unto the Levites these cities with their suburbs, as the Lord commanded by the hand of Moses.
9 And they gave out of the tribe of the children of Judah, and out of the tribe of the children of Simeon, these cities which are here mentioned by name,
10 Which the children of Aaron, being of the families of the Kohathites, who were of the children of Levi, had: for theirs was the first lot.
11 And they gave them the city of Arba the father of Anak, which city is Hebron, in the hill country of Judah, with the suburbs thereof round about it.
12 But the fields of the city, and the villages thereof, gave they to Caleb the son of Jephunneh for his possession.
13 Thus they gave to the children of Aaron the priest Hebron with her suburbs, to be a city of refuge for the slayer; and Libnah with her suburbs,
14 And Jattir with her suburbs, and Eshtemoa with her suburbs,
15 And Holon with her suburbs, and Debir with her suburbs,
16 And Ain with her suburbs, and Juttah with her suburbs, and Beth-shemesh with her suburbs; nine cities out of those two tribes.
17 And out of the tribe of Benjamin, Gibeon with her suburbs, Geba with her suburbs,
18 Anathoth with her suburbs, and Almon with her suburbs; four cities.
19 All the cities of the children of Aaron, the priests, were thirteen cities with their suburbs.
20 And the families of the children of Kohath, the Levites which remained of the children of Kohath, even they had the cities of their lot out of the tribe of Ephraim.
21 For they gave them Shechem with her suburbs in mount Ephraim, to be a city of refuge for the slayer; and Gezer with her suburbs,
22 And Kibzaim with her suburbs, and Beth-horon with her suburbs; four cities.
23 And out of the tribe of Dan, Eltekeh with her suburbs, Gibbethon with her suburbs,
24 Aijalon with her suburbs, Gath-rimmon with her suburbs; four cities.
25 And out of the half tribe of Manasseh, Tanach with her suburbs, and Gath-rimmon with her suburbs; two cities.
26 All the cities were ten with their suburbs for the families of the children of Kohath that remained.
27 And unto the children of Gershon, of the families of the Levites, out of the other half tribe of Manasseh they gave Golan in Bashan with her suburbs, to be a city of refuge for the slayer; and Beesh-terah with her suburbs; two cities.
28 And out of the tribe of Issachar, Kishon with her suburbs, Dabareh with her suburbs,
29 Jarmuth with her suburbs, En-gannim with her suburbs; four cities.
30 And out of the tribe of Asher, Mishal with her suburbs, Abdon with her suburbs,
31 Helkath with her suburbs, and Rehob with her suburbs; four cities.
32 And out of the tribe of Naphtali, Kedesh in Galilee with her suburbs, to be a city of refuge for the slayer; and Hammoth-dor with her suburbs, and Kartan with her suburbs; three cities.
33 All the cities of the Gershonites according to their families were thirteen cities with their suburbs.
34 And unto the families of the children of Merari, the rest of the Levites, out of the tribe of Zebulun, Jokneam with her suburbs, and Kartah with her suburbs,
35 Dimnah with her suburbs, Nahalal with her suburbs; four cities.
36 And out of the tribe of Reuben, Bezer with her suburbs, and Jahazah with her suburbs,
37 Kedemoth with her suburbs, and Mephaath with her suburbs; four cities.
38 And out of the tribe of Gad, Ramoth in Gilead with her suburbs, to be a city of refuge for the slayer; and Mahanaim with her suburbs,
39 Heshbon with her suburbs, Jazer with her suburbs; four cities in all.
40 So all the cities for the children of Merari by their families, which were remaining of the families of the Levites, were by their lot twelve cities.
41 All the cities of the Levites within the possession of the children of Israel were forty and eight cities with their suburbs.
42 These cities were every one with their suburbs round about them: thus were all these cities.
43 And the Lord gave unto Israel all the land which he sware to give unto their fathers; and they possessed it, and dwelt therein.
44 And the Lord gave them rest round about, according to all that he sware unto their fathers: and there stood not a man of all their enemies before them; the Lord delivered all their enemies into their hand.
45 There failed not ought of any good thing which the Lord had spoken unto the house of Israel; all came to pass.
